Double Strip today!

by jathevan on May 7, 2010 at 12:34 am
Posted In: Blog

Wow! A double page! Why? I’ll tell you!

As most of you know, when Jimmy and the Hammer started, it was on a two times a week schedule. Fairly recently, I cut back to once a week because I hit an incredibly busy patch.

Later, life opened up a bit again. But I decided to instead of going back to two updates a week, I would stay at one update a week, and do an additional art project not directly related to my webcomic. This would give me an opportunity to grow as an artist in a much broader fashion.

The response to this was widely positive. Where not positive, it was at least supportive. And where not supportive, it was at least silent in its dissapproval.

There was, however, one exception: my mom. She has, on multiple occasions, pointed out to me how much better two updates a week is than just one.

So, today, the update before Mother’s Day, I give you two pages.

Happy Mother’s Day!
